new from Lomography is the latest incarnation of the LOMO LC-A+, in the form of White Japan Special Edition. as the name suggests, this Special Edition LC-A+ is in white, instead of the usual black body. aside from the obvious color difference, the Special Edition LC-A+ gets some artistic treatment in the form of fine leather embossed with the image of “Karesansui” and “25” (on the back of the camera) in honor of the Lomo LC-A+’s 25th anniversary.

this LC-A+ features the usual Minitar 1 32/2.8 lens, MX switch for easy multiple exposures, hot shoes for external flash and cable release thread for long exposure and low-light photography. further setting the Special Edition apart from its black sibling, is the customized wooden box and an exclusive Lomo L-Case White edition.

if you are a fan of the lomography, or the LC-A+ to be more specific, you would be glad to know this camera is limited to 1000 pieces world wide. at US$409.90, its close to 100 bucks cheaper than the Deluxe Kit but still expensive if you are not a true blue “lomo-head”. did lomography introduced this white edition to coincide with the winter season? hmmm.. white Japan… white winter… white christmas… get it?
